Learn More About Panama Liga Pro (Basketball)

The Panama Liga Pro is the premier professional basketball league in Panama. It features the best basketball talent in the country, with teams representing various regions and cities. The league has grown in popularity over the years, with an increasing number of local and international players joining the teams. It operates in a format similar to other professional basketball leagues, typically consisting of a regular season, playoffs, and a championship series.

Key Elements of the Panama Liga Pro:

  1. Teams: The league usually has around 6-10 teams competing each season. These teams are composed of a mix of local Panamanian talent and foreign players, often from countries like the United States, other Latin American nations, and Europe. Teams are typically named after cities or sponsors, and the level of competition is high, with some teams being considered more dominant than others.

  2. Season Format: The season generally begins with a regular round-robin format where each team plays multiple games. After the regular season, the top teams advance to the playoffs, which culminates in a finals series to determine the league champion. The playoff format can vary from year to year, but it often follows a best-of series format, such as best of 5 or best of 7.

  3. Game Structure: A typical game consists of four quarters, with each quarter lasting 10-12 minutes. The rules and style of play align with international basketball standards, meaning the game emphasizes skillful play, strategy, and teamwork. Fans can expect fast-paced action, with a mix of both high-scoring and strategic defensive battles.

  4. Player Development: The league is also a vital avenue for developing Panamanian basketball talent. Many players use the Liga Pro as a stepping stone to play abroad, either in higher-level leagues or with national teams. The league has also helped raise the profile of basketball in Panama, inspiring younger players to pursue the sport professionally.

  5. Sponsorships and Media: The Liga Pro has several sponsorships from local and international companies, which help fund the teams, games, and overall league operations. Games are typically broadcasted on television or through online platforms, and the league often attracts a dedicated following both locally and internationally.

How to Bet on Panama Liga Pro Basketball:

Betting on the Panama Liga Pro basketball league can be similar to betting on other professional basketball leagues around the world. Here’s a breakdown of how you can approach betting on the league:

  1. Choose a Betting Platform: You will first need to select a legal and reputable sportsbook or betting platform that offers odds for the Panama Liga Pro. These platforms will list upcoming games, odds, and various betting markets. Make sure the platform is reliable, secure, and licensed to operate in your region.

  2. Types of Bets:

    • Moneyline Bets: This is the most straightforward form of betting, where you bet on which team will win the game. The odds reflect the perceived likelihood of one team winning over the other.
    • Point Spread: This type of bet involves betting on a team to either cover or fail to cover a set point difference. For example, if a team is favored to win by 6 points, you bet on whether they will win by more than 6 points or not.
    • Over/Under (Total Points): This bet involves wagering on whether the total points scored in the game will be over or under a certain number set by the sportsbook.
    • Prop Bets: These bets are more specific and involve individual player performance, such as betting on how many points a particular player will score or how many rebounds a player will grab in a game.
    • Futures Bets: In this type of betting, you wager on the eventual outcome of the league, such as which team will win the championship at the end of the season.
  3. Research and Analysis: To make more informed bets, it's crucial to research the teams, players, and recent performances. Pay attention to the form of the teams leading up to the game, head-to-head statistics, injuries, and any other factors that could influence the outcome. Watching games, checking news reports, and analyzing statistics can help improve your betting strategy.

  4. Live Betting: Many sportsbooks offer live or in-play betting, where you can place bets as the game progresses. Live betting can be more dynamic, as the odds fluctuate based on the action in the game. This type of betting requires a keen sense of the game’s flow and is popular among experienced bettors.

  5. Bet Responsibly: As with all forms of gambling, it’s important to bet responsibly. Set a budget for your bets, avoid chasing losses, and only bet what you can afford to lose. Betting should be an enjoyable activity, and if it starts to feel like a problem, it's important to seek help.

  6. Promotions and Bonuses: Many sportsbooks offer bonuses or promotions for new users or for betting on specific events, so take advantage of these when available. These can include free bets, enhanced odds, or deposit bonuses, which can increase your chances of winning or provide more value in your bets.

By following these steps, you can engage in betting on the Panama Liga Pro and potentially profit from your knowledge of the league. However, always remember that sports betting is unpredictable, and while research and analysis can improve your chances, there’s no guaranteed outcome.
